If you are running a small tank <10gal I'd suggest siphoning the poo out when possible. less detritus and recirculating nutrients in the tank, the better it will be in the long run. Some worms and pods and other snails, crabs and even some corals will eat it as well as tangs and scats. It isn't a major thing. it will be if your export of waste is less than that which is produced.
